Events Assistant / Personal Assistant

London | Hybrid (Office + On-site Events) | Full-time 

A premium, design-led food & beverage brand specialising in artisan Japanese matcha and green tea is seeking an Events Assistant / Personal Assistant to support both live brand activations and day-to-day executive administration.

This is a varied, hands-on role ideal for someone highly organised, proactive, and comfortable switching between event delivery and PA responsibilities. You will play a key role in ensuring events run smoothly while also supporting the leadership team with scheduling, coordination, and administrative tasks.

Key Responsibilities

Events & Brand Activations

  • Support planning, setup, delivery, and breakdown of events, tastings, pop-ups, and markets

  • Transport, organise, and prepare event materials, products, and equipment

  • Represent the brand at events, engaging customers with warmth and professionalism

  • Assist with product education, sampling, and point-of-sale transactions

  • Ensure brand presentation is polished and consistent

  • Support post-event wrap-up, stock checks, and feedback collection

Personal Assistant & Administration

  • Manage calendars, schedule meetings, and coordinate calls

  • Provide reminders for upcoming events, deadlines, and priority tasks

  • Assist with inbox management and basic correspondence

  • Support travel planning and logistics when required

  • Help organise documents, files, and internal records

  • Provide general administrative support to the leadership team

About You

  • Friendly, confident, and professional in customer-facing environments

  • Highly organised with strong attention to detail

  • Proactive self-starter who can manage multiple priorities

  • Comfortable working independently and taking initiative

  • Flexible availability, including weekends and occasional evenings

  • Able to lift and transport supplies up to 15kg

  • Right to work in the UK

Nice to Have

  • Previous experience in events, hospitality, retail, or customer service

  • PA, EA, or administrative experience

  • Interest in wellness, food & beverage, or lifestyle brands

  • Experience using Google Workspace, calendars, or basic CRM tools

What We Offer

  • Salary: £30,000 – £40,000 per annum (depending on experience)

  • Flexible working arrangements and a hybrid schedule

  • Opportunities to work at high-quality brand events and activations

  • Product discounts and staff perks

  • A supportive, collaborative team environment
